क्योंकि ISNUMERIC
ऐसे प्रश्न का उत्तर देता है जो कोई नहीं कभी पूछना चाहता हूँ:
यही कारण है कि TRY_CONVERT
अंततः 2012 में पेश किया गया था - एक विशिष्ट . के बारे में एक प्रश्न का उत्तर देने के लिए डेटा प्रकार जिसकी आप परवाह कर सकते हैं।
पुराने संस्करणों के लिए, आप आमतौर पर सबसे अच्छा LIKE
. का उपयोग कर सकते हैं स्ट्रिंग पैटर्न की पहचान करने के लिए आप करते हैं परिवर्तित करने का प्रयास करना चाहते हैं।
उदा. यदि आप केवल अंकों का पता लगाना चाहते हैं, तो Value NOT LIKE '%[^0-9]%'
का उपयोग करें , जो Value
. मांगता है तार जो नहीं करते हैं कोई ऐसा वर्ण शामिल करें जो नहीं है एक अंक।